What Defines a Cryptocurrency Casino?
A cryptocurrency casino is an online gambling platform that accepts digital possessions as the main legal tender. Unlike traditional websites that need charge card deposits or bank wires, these platforms utilize blockchain wallets to deal with transactions.
These gambling establishments can be categorized into two primary types:
- Crypto Online Casino-Only Casinos: These platforms operate exclusively on blockchain innovation. They typically include "Provably Fair" algorithms, which allow users to validate the stability of every individual video game outcome.
- Hybrid Casinos: These websites accept both standard fiat currencies (GBP, EUR, GBP) and numerous cryptocurrencies. They function as a bridge for gamers who are transitioning into the digital possession area however still make use of standard banking techniques.

Maybe the most substantial development presented by the cryptocurrency casino is the "Provably Fair" system. In a conventional online casino, the player should rely on the site's "Random Number Generator" (RNG) and the third-party auditors that validate it.
In a provably fair system, the game result is generated utilizing cryptographic hashing. Gamers can utilize open-source tools to check the server seed, the customer seed, and the nonce (the number used when). By inputting these variables into a verification tool, players can mathematically show that the result of their spin or hand was not controlled by the platform. This gets rid of the "black box" element of traditional betting.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Is it legal to bet with cryptocurrency?
The legality of cryptocurrency gaming depends upon your nation of house. While the assets themselves might be legal, online betting laws vary substantially by area. Always check your local guidelines before signing up.
2. Can I lose my cash if the crypto value drops?
Yes. If you transfer one Bitcoin and win, however the market value of Bitcoin visit 20% while you are playing, your "worth" in fiat has reduced. Numerous players reduce this by utilizing stablecoins like GBPT.
3. What is a "Provably Fair" video game?
It is an innovation that permits you to verify that the outcomes of your games are random and not manipulated by the casino, utilizing cryptographic evidence.
4. Are anonymous casinos safe?
"Anonymous" gambling establishments often need very little data for sign-up, however this can in some cases be a red flag. Always search for casinos that have a strong performance history and positive neighborhood feedback, despite their registration requirements.
5. How do I withdraw my earnings?
Just browse to the cashier area, select your cryptocurrency, input your individual wallet address, and confirm the withdrawal. Guarantee the address matches the currency (e.g., do not send out BTC to an ETH address).
